Big Springs sits on the slope-side terrain adjacent to Northstar California's ski runs in Placer County along Highway 267 through Martis Valley. Single-family chalets and mountain estates here sit directly on or within walking distance of the resort terrain, delivering ski-in, ski-out ownership that Village condo buildings cannot replicate through gondola proximity alone.
Buyers who have evaluated the Northstar Village condo product and prioritized square footage, private outdoor space, and ownership freedom over walkable village amenities arrive at Big Springs as the natural next step. The Big Springs Northstar HOA governs the sub-area as a residential association rather than a resort management entity.
Big Springs single-family homes trade between $1.5M and $5M+ in Placer County, California, covering a range of property types that reflects the sub-area's evolution from original ski chalet stock to contemporary custom mountain estates.
Terrain adjacency is the primary value driver within the Big Springs price band; a property that skis directly onto a groomed run or sits within a short traverse of the lifts commands a premium over a comparable structure that requires a longer ski-out or a lift shuttle to reach the base. Buyers must verify each specific property's terrain relationship before committing to a purchase at any price tier.

Genuine ski-in ski-out at Big Springs means the ski runs are part of the property's daily relationship with the mountain rather than a proximity claim based on gondola distance. The best-positioned Big Springs homes allow owners to clip into bindings on their own property, ski a groomed run directly to the lift, and return home at the end of the day on snow without removing skis until the front door.
Direct run adjacency: Properties on the sub-area's ski corridor positions allow ski-out from the property edge onto groomed terrain without traversing roads or ungroomed sections
Morning powder access: The ability to reach first tracks from home without a vehicle eliminates the timing pressure that drives ski cabin buyers to prioritize this specific ownership model over every other ski-access format
Afternoon return on snow: Skiing home rather than to a parking structure is the experiential differentiator that Big Springs owners most consistently cite as the defining daily advantage
Big Springs delivers a privacy level that the Village base area cannot offer, residential streets set back from the pedestrian commercial core, private lots with natural tree separation between neighboring structures, and a daily rhythm that feels like mountain living rather than resort visiting.
Resort amenities, including the Big Springs Gondola, the Village dining and retail corridor, and the Northstar California lift network, remain accessible on foot or skis from Big Springs properties. The sub-area sits close enough to the resort infrastructure to use it daily but far enough from the base area density to function as a genuine residential address rather than a resort accommodation option.
Big Springs falls within the Tahoe Mountain Club's membership geography, giving Big Springs homeowners the option to add golf access at the Old Greenwood Jack Nicklaus Signature course and the Gray's Crossing Peter Jacobsen course through a Tahoe Mountain Club membership. This optional golf layer is not included in the Big Springs HOA; it requires a separate membership purchase, but its availability gives Big Springs owners a year-round resort lifestyle extension that purely ski-focused mountain addresses in other parts of the Sierra do not offer.
For buyers who want both ski-in ski-out winter access and private championship golf in summer, Big Springs within the Tahoe Mountain Club geography is one of the few addresses in California that delivers both within the same property ownership context.
